Job Description

Enterprise Systems supports the Virginia Tech community by developing, coordinating, and managing application software systems and enterprise data to provide critical information services for university constituents. In this position, you will design, develop, and document front-end user interfaces under general direction. You will provide technical input on complex projects and serve as an expert in one or more business or functional areas.

In addition, the Front-end Developer will:
● Participate in the development, implementation, deployment, and testing of responsive user interface components. Includes new functionality, enhancements, and defect resolution.
● Prepare detailed program specifications, identifying required inputs, coordinating the solution deployment with the user department, and ensuring satisfactory results.
● Investigate user problems and needs, identify their source, and determine possible solutions.
● Analyze user enhancement requests to include identifying potential problem areas and recommend optimum solution approaches.
● Handle multiple assignments simultaneously and collaborate with colleagues.
● Instruct, guide, and check the work of other technical personnel and perform quality assurance review.

Required Qualifications

● Master’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Business, or a related field, or an equivalent combination of education, training, and progressively responsible experience.
● Demonstrated experience with React, JavaScript frameworks, and libraries.
● Demonstrated experience with React Material UI.
● Demonstrated experience performing unit/integration testing with Jest/React libraries.
● Demonstrated experience in full lifecycle user interface development including requirements gathering, business analysis, development, troubleshooting, testing, and implementation
● Demonstrated proficiency with HTML, CSS, and JavaScript
● Demonstrated understanding of responsive design principles
● Exposure to Web Accessibility Content Guidelines (WCAG)
● Strong interpersonal, organizational, critical thinking, attention to detail, and communication skills with the ability to work effectively across internal, external organizations, and virtual teams

Preferred Qualifications

● Web Accessibility certification, such as IAAP WAS
● Experience with Git and automated CI/CD pipelines
● Experience with Docker containers and/or managing applications in a containerized environment
● Experience developing React applications using TanStack Query (React Query).
● Experience with business processes and applications supporting Higher Education
● Experience working with Ellucian Banner systems

About Virginia Tech

Dedicated to its motto, Ut Prosim (That I May Serve), Virginia Tech pushes the boundaries of knowledge by taking a hands-on, transdisciplinary approach to preparing scholars to be leaders and problem-solvers. A comprehensive land-grant institution that enhances the quality of life in Virginia and throughout the world, Virginia Tech is an inclusive community dedicated to knowledge, discovery, and creativity. The university offers more than 280 majors to a diverse enrollment of more than 36,000 undergraduate, graduate, and professional students in eight undergraduate colleges, a school of medicine, a veterinary medicine college, Graduate School, and Honors CollegeThe university has a significant presence across Virginia, including Blacksburg, the greater Washington, D.C. area, the Health Sciences and Technology Campus in Roanoke, sites in Newport News and Richmond, and numerous Extension offices and research institutes. A leading global research institution, Virginia Tech conducts more than $650 million in research annually.
